Understanding Debt and Loans in the Context of Injuries: When an individual sustains an injury, the financial implications can be significant. Medical bills, loss of income due to inability to work, and other related expenses can quickly add up, leading to the accumulation of debt. In such cases, loans may be seen as a viable option to cover these expenses and manage the financial impact of the injury. Advocacy in Managing Debt and Loans: Advocacy plays a crucial role in helping individuals facing injuries manage their debt and loans effectively. Advocates can provide valuable support and resources to help individuals understand their rights and options when it comes to financial assistance. They can also negotiate with lenders on behalf of the injured individual to create manageable repayment plans or explore debt relief options. Advocates can also help individuals navigate the complexities of the healthcare system to ensure that they receive the necessary medical treatment without incurring overwhelming debt. By educating individuals on available resources and advocating for their rights, advocates can empower them to make informed decisions and take control of their financial situation. Preventative Advocacy Measures: In addition to providing support during times of crisis, advocacy can also play a role in preventative measures. By promoting financial literacy and awareness of available resources, advocates can help individuals better prepare for unexpected events such as injuries. This can include educating individuals on insurance options, emergency savings, and other financial tools that can help mitigate the impact of injuries on their finances.
